Я пытаюсь понять правила, касающиеся вывода типов, так как я хотел бы включить его в свой...
Я делаю академическое упражнение (для личностного роста).Я хочу найти языки программирования,...
Как работает алгоритм Хиндли-Милнера, когда есть перегруженные функции? В простой форме (без...
Я хотел бы расширить алгоритм W до логического вывода кортежей и списков в F #, априори есть только...
Этот код компилируется: #[derive(Debug, Default)] struct Example; impl Example { fn...
Я недавно изучал λ-исчисление.Я понял разницу между нетипизированным и типизированным λ-исчислением
Есть ли в C ++ реализация типа Damas-Hindley-Milner , предпочтительно с использованием современных...
Может кто-нибудь объяснить шаг за шагом вывод типа в следующей программе F #: let rec sumList lst =...
Я работаю над простой системой, основанной на потоке данных (представьте, что это редактор / среда...
Что я делаю: Я пишу небольшую систему интерпретатора, которая может анализировать файл, превращать...
Чтение Недостатки системы типов Scala по сравнению с Haskell? , я должен спросить: что именно...
Я ищу информацию об известном алгоритме Дамаса-Хиндли-Милнера для определения типа для...
Я пытался сделать хвостовую рекурсивную версию этой очень простой функции SML: fun suffixes [] =...
В Andrew Koenig's Анекдот о выводе типа ML , автор использует реализацию сортировка слиянием в...
Каковы пределы вывода типа? Какие системы типов не имеют общего алгоритма вывода?
Хиндли-Милнер - это система типов, которая является основой систем типов многих известных языков...
Я встречал этот термин Хиндли-Милнер , и я не уверен, что понял, что это значит. Я прочитал...